The cheapest way to get from Yuba City to Anderson is to drive which costs $18 - $28 and takes 1h 59m.
The fastest way to get from Yuba City to Anderson is to drive which takes 1h 59m and costs $18 - $28.
No, there is no direct bus from Yuba City station to Anderson. However, there are services departing from Marysville Amtrak Station and arriving at South St at E. Center St via Chico Bus Station and Downtown Passenger Terminal Gate 9.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 27m.
The distance between Yuba City and Anderson is 137 miles. The road distance is 104.1 miles.
The best way to get from Yuba City to Anderson without a car is to bus and train and line 9 bus which takes 5h 15m and costs $40 - $80.
It takes approximately 5h 15m to get from Yuba City to Anderson, including transfers.
Yuba City to Anderson bus services, operated by Amtrak, depart from Marysville Amtrak Station.
Yuba City to Anderson bus services, operated by Amtrak, arrive at Chico Amtrak station.
Yes, the driving distance between Yuba City to Anderson is 104 miles. It takes approximately 1h 59m to drive from Yuba City to Anderson.
